Crossroads.js和require.js

时间:2011-12-23 16:37:28

标签: javascript requirejs

我想使用带有require.js的crossroads.js来根据URL确定要求的文件。

我将十字路口设置为Router.js文件中的依赖项,如果我直接从crossroads.js文件中调用console.log(十字路口),我将获得十字路口对象。然而,它没有传递给Router.js文件,它的null或未定义...如果有人之前有这个问题,不知道吗?

提前干杯。

1 个答案:

答案 0 :(得分:1)

Crossroads.js从一开始就与RequireJS一起使用(我在所有项目中都使用RequireJS)你可能在你的路径上有一些错误的配置,或者期望暴露全局crossroads var(这不会发生在在RequireJS之前加载AMD环境或者可能是十字路口(它会跳过AMD define进程)。